Raciocínio Probabilístico - Representação artística
A Tomada de Decisão em Ambientes de Incerteza: O Papel do Raciocínio Probabilístico na IA Cognitiva
Como as máquinas conseguem tomar decisões em situações de incerteza? Essa pergunta é central para o desenvolvimento da inteligência artificial cognitiva e, mais especificamente, para o entendimento do raciocínio probabilístico. Este conceito é fundamental para a construção de sistemas que imitam a capacidade humana de lidar com incertezas e variáveis complexas. Neste artigo, exploraremos a definição de raciocínio probabilístico, suas comparações com abordagens determinísticas, estruturas utilizadas, aplicações práticas em diversos setores, e os desafios enfrentados na sua implementação.
O Que é Raciocínio Probabilístico e Sua Relevância
O raciocínio probabilístico é uma abordagem que permite a modelagem e a inferência em situações onde a certeza não é garantida. Ao contrário do raciocínio determinístico, que assume que as informações são precisas e completas, o raciocínio probabilístico lida com a incerteza, permitindo que sistemas de IA façam previsões e tomem decisões baseadas em probabilidades.
Essa abordagem é crucial na IA cognitiva, pois muitos problemas do mundo real envolvem incertezas. Por exemplo, ao diagnosticar uma doença, um médico não tem certeza absoluta sobre a condição do paciente, mas pode usar informações disponíveis para calcular a probabilidade de diferentes diagnósticos.
Raciocínio Determinístico vs. Raciocínio Probabilístico
A principal diferença entre raciocínio determinístico e raciocínio probabilístico reside na forma como lidam com a incerteza. O raciocínio determinístico é baseado em regras fixas e resultados previsíveis; por exemplo, em um sistema de controle de tráfego, se um semáforo está vermelho, os carros devem parar.
Por outro lado, o raciocínio probabilístico permite que sistemas considerem múltiplas possibilidades e incertezas. Um exemplo prático seria um assistente virtual que sugere um restaurante: ele pode calcular a probabilidade de um usuário gostar de um lugar com base em suas preferências anteriores, mesmo que não tenha certeza absoluta.
Estruturas e Modelos de Raciocínio Probabilístico
Existem várias estruturas e modelos que facilitam o raciocínio probabilístico, entre os quais se destacam:
Redes Bayesianas
As redes bayesianas são um modelo gráfico que representa um conjunto de variáveis e suas dependências condicionais por meio de um grafo acíclico dirigido. Elas são amplamente utilizadas para inferência e aprendizado em ambientes incertos. Por exemplo, em um sistema de diagnóstico médico, uma rede bayesiana pode ajudar a determinar a probabilidade de uma doença com base em sintomas observados.
Modelos de Markov
Os modelos de Markov são utilizados para modelar sistemas que mudam de estado ao longo do tempo, onde a probabilidade de transição para um novo estado depende apenas do estado atual. Um exemplo clássico é o uso de modelos de Markov em sistemas de recomendação, onde a próxima ação do usuário é prevista com base em suas interações anteriores.
Aplicações Práticas em Setores Diversos
Diagnóstico Médico
Um exemplo notável de raciocínio probabilístico em ação é o IBM Watson, que utiliza algoritmos de raciocínio probabilístico para ajudar médicos a diagnosticar doenças. O sistema analisa grandes volumes de dados médicos e históricos de pacientes para calcular a probabilidade de diferentes diagnósticos, melhorando a precisão e a rapidez do atendimento.
Análise de Risco em Finanças
No setor financeiro, empresas como o Goldman Sachs utilizam raciocínio probabilístico para análise de risco. Modelos probabilísticos ajudam a prever a probabilidade de inadimplência de um cliente, permitindo que instituições financeiras tomem decisões mais informadas sobre concessão de crédito.
Sistemas de Recomendação
Empresas como o Google utilizam raciocínio probabilístico em seus sistemas de recomendação. Ao analisar o comportamento do usuário e as interações anteriores, o sistema pode prever quais produtos ou conteúdos têm maior probabilidade de serem do interesse do usuário, personalizando a experiência.
Integração em Sistemas de IA: Assistentes Virtuais e Chatbots
A integração do raciocínio probabilístico em sistemas de IA, como assistentes virtuais e chatbots, é um campo em expansão. Esses sistemas utilizam algoritmos de raciocínio probabilístico para entender e responder a perguntas de forma mais natural e precisa. Por exemplo, um assistente virtual pode calcular a probabilidade de um usuário querer saber sobre o clima com base em sua localização e no horário do dia, oferecendo respostas mais relevantes.
Implementação de Modelos de Raciocínio Probabilístico
A implementação de um modelo de raciocínio probabilístico envolve várias etapas:
-
Coleta de Dados: A qualidade dos dados é fundamental. Dados de alta qualidade são essenciais para treinar modelos eficazes.
-
Treinamento de Modelos: Utilizando ferramentas como TensorFlow Probability, os modelos são treinados para aprender as relações entre variáveis e suas probabilidades.
-
Validação: Após o treinamento, os modelos devem ser validados para garantir que suas previsões sejam precisas e confiáveis.
Uma analogia útil é a previsão do tempo: assim como meteorologistas usam dados históricos e modelos probabilísticos para prever o clima, sistemas de IA utilizam dados e algoritmos para prever resultados em diferentes cenários.
Riscos e Limitações do Raciocínio Probabilístico
Embora o raciocínio probabilístico seja uma ferramenta poderosa, ele não é isento de desafios. A dependência de dados de qualidade é uma limitação significativa; dados imprecisos podem levar a previsões erradas. Além disso, modelar incertezas complexas pode ser desafiador, e há debates entre especialistas sobre a eficácia do raciocínio probabilístico em comparação com outras abordagens, como o aprendizado profundo.
Reflexões Finais sobre o Futuro do Raciocínio Probabilístico
O raciocínio probabilístico desempenha um papel crucial na evolução da inteligência artificial cognitiva. À medida que a tecnologia avança, espera-se que mais empresas adotem essa abordagem para melhorar a precisão e a eficácia de suas soluções. Profissionais que desejam implementar raciocínio probabilístico em suas soluções de IA devem focar na coleta de dados de qualidade e na escolha de modelos adequados para suas necessidades específicas.
Em um mundo cada vez mais complexo e incerto, o raciocínio probabilístico se destaca como uma ferramenta essencial para a tomada de decisões informadas e eficazes na inteligência artificial.
Aplicações de Raciocínio Probabilístico
- Diagnóstico médico, usando redes Bayesianas para calcular a probabilidade de doenças com base em sintomas
- Sistemas de recomendação, ajustando as sugestões com base nas preferências e histórico do usuário
- Previsão de falhas em sistemas complexos, como máquinas e equipamentos
- Análise de risco em finanças, calculando as probabilidades de eventos econômicos